/* TimingData - Holds data for translating beats<->seconds. */ #ifndef TIMING_DATA_H #define TIMING_DATA_H #include "NoteTypes.h" #include "PrefsManager.h" struct lua_State; #define COMPARE(x) if(x!=other.x) return false; struct BPMSegment { BPMSegment() : m_iStartRow(-1), m_fBPS(-1.0f) { } BPMSegment( int s, float b ) { m_iStartRow = max( 0, s ); SetBPM( b ); } int m_iStartRow; float m_fBPS; void SetBPM( float f ) { m_fBPS = f / 60.0f; } float GetBPM() const { return m_fBPS * 60.0f; } bool operator==( const BPMSegment &other ) const { COMPARE( m_iStartRow ); COMPARE( m_fBPS ); return true; } bool operator!=( const BPMSegment &other ) const { return !operator==(other); } bool operator<( const BPMS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ow < other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ator<=( const BPMSegment &other ) const { return ( operator<(other) || operator==(other) ); } bool operator>( const BPMS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ow > other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ator>=( const BPMSegment &other ) const { return ( operator>(other) || operator==(other) ); } }; struct StopSegment { StopSegment() : m_iStartRow(-1), m_fStopSeconds(-1.0f), m_bDelay(false) { } StopSegment( int s, float f ) { m_iStartRow = max( 0, s ); m_fStopSeconds = PREFSMAN->m_bQuirksMode ? f : max( 0.0f, f ); m_bDelay = false; // no delay by default } StopSegment( int s, float f, bool d ) { m_iStartRow = max( 0, s ); m_fStopSeconds = PREFSMAN->m_bQuirksMode ? f : max( 0.0f, f ); m_bDelay = d; } int m_iStartRow; float m_fStopSeconds; bool m_bDelay; // if true, treat this stop as a Pump delay instead bool operator==( const StopSegment &other ) const { COMPARE( m_iStartRow ); COMPARE( m_fStopSeconds ); COMPARE( m_bDelay ); return true; } bool operator!=( const StopSegment &other ) const { return !operator==(other); } // Delays need to come before stops to not render them pointless. bool operator<( const StopSegment &other ) const { return ( m_iStartRow < other.m_iStartRow ) || ( m_iStartRow == other.m_iStartRow && m_bDelay && !other.m_bDelay ); } bool operator<=( const StopSegment &other ) const { return ( operator<(other) || operator==(other) ); } bool operator>( const StopSegment &other ) const { return ( m_iStartRow > other.m_iStartRow ) || ( m_iStartRow == other.m_iStartRow && !m_bDelay && other.m_bDelay ); } bool operator>=( const StopSegment &other ) const { return ( operator>(other) || operator==(other) ); } }; /* This only supports simple time signatures. The upper number (called the numerator here, though this isn't * properly a fraction) is the number of beats per measure. The lower number (denominator here) * is the note value representing one beat. */ struct TimeSignatureSegment { TimeSignatureSegment() : m_iStartRow(-1), m_iNumerator(4), m_iDenominator(4) { } TimeSignatureSegment( int r, int n ) { m_iStartRow = max( 0, r ); m_iNumerator = n; m_iDenominator = 64; // Hope we don't need this many. } TimeSignatureSegment( int r, int n, int d ) { m_iStartRow = max( 0, r ); m_iNumerator = n; m_iDenominator = d; } int m_iStartRow; int m_iNumerator; int m_iDenominator; /* With BeatToNoteRow(1) rows per beat, then we should have BeatToNoteRow(1)*m_iNumerator * beats per measure. But if we assume that every BeatToNoteRow(1) rows is a quarter note, * and we want the beats to be 1/m_iDenominator notes, then we should have * BeatToNoteRow(1)*4 is rows per whole note and thus BeatToNoteRow(1)*4/m_iDenominator is * rows per beat. Multiplying by m_iNumerator gives rows per measure. */ int GetNoteRowsPerMeasure() const { return BeatToNoteRow(1) * 4 * m_iNumerator / m_iDenominator; } bool operator==( const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{ COMPARE( m_iStartRow ); COMPARE( m_iNumerator ); COMPARE( m_iDenominator ); return true; } bool operator!=( const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{ return !operator==(other); } bool operator<( const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ow < other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ator<= (const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{ return ( operator<(other) || operator==(other) ); } bool operator>( const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ow > other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ator>= (const TimeSignatureSegment &other ) const { return ( operator>(other) || operator==(other) ); } }; /* A warp segment is used to replicate the effects of Negative BPMs without * abusing negative BPMs. Negative BPMs should be converted to warp segments. * WarpAt=WarpTo is the format, where both are in beats. (Technically they're * both rows though.) */ struct WarpSegment { WarpSegment() : m_iStartRow(-1), m_fWarpBeats(-1) { } WarpSegment( int s, float b ){ m_iStartRow = max( 0, s ); m_fWarpBeats = max( 0, b ); } int m_iStartRow; float m_fWarpBeats; bool operator==( const WarpSegment &other ) const { COMPARE( m_iStartRow ); COMPARE( m_fWarpBeats ); return true; } bool operator!=( const WarpSegment &other ) const { return !operator==(other); } bool operator<( const WarpS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ow < other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ator<=( const WarpSegment &other ) const { return ( operator<(other) || operator==(other) ); } bool operator>( const WarpS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ow > other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ator>=( const WarpSegment &other ) const { return ( operator>(other) || operator==(other) ); } }; /* * A tickcount segment is used to better replicate the checkpoint hold * system used by various based video games. The number is used to * represent how many ticks can be counted in one beat. */ struct TickcountSegment { TickcountSegment() : m_iStartRow(-1), m_iTicks(2) { } TickcountSegment( int s, int t ){ m_iStartRow = max( 0, s ); m_iTicks = max( 1, t ); } int m_iStartRow; int m_iTicks; bool operator==(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{ COMPARE( m_iStartRow ); COMPARE( m_iTicks ); return true; } bool operator!=(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{ return !operator==(other); } bool operator<(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ow < other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ator<=(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{ return ( operator<(other) || operator==(other) ); } bool operator>(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{ return m_iStartRow > other.m_iStartRow; } bool operator>=( const TickcountSegment &other ) const { return ( operator>(other) || operator==(other) );
